stakeholders are the people who directly or indirectly contribute their services towards the organization. their contribution helps the firms to survive in the market and to reach its goals. the stakeholders to a firm includes:
shareholders/owners: the people who provided capital and establishes business. these people concern about fiancial inputs and profitability of the firm. they looks for the firm\'s wealth maximization.
board of directors/ top management: these people frame different strategies towards running of the firm. those may be called as strategic decisions. these decisions influece the firm as a whole and these people are key people in the survival of the firm. even legally they are answerable persons to the firm\'s actions.
employees: these people contribute their knowledge, time and efforts towards the firm. they execute the strategies planned by the top level management. these are full time workers and consider the departmental activities, and works to achieve the goals.
customers: these people encourages the firm by purchasing their products and services.
government/ society: they supports the firms by providing licencing and security.
